@@ -0,0 +1,118 @@ | ||
<?php | ||
/** | ||
* Block support to enable per-section styling of block types via | ||
* block style variations. | ||
* | ||
* @package gutenberg | ||
*/ |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Get the class name for this application of this blocks variation styles. | ||
* | ||
* @param array $block Block object. | ||
* @param string $variation Slug for the variation.. | ||
* | ||
* @return string The unique class name. | ||
*/ | ||
function gutenberg_get_variation_class_name( $block, $variation ) { | ||
return 'is-style-' . $variation . '-' . md5( serialize( $block ) ); | ||
} |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Update the block content with the variation's class name. | ||
* | ||
* @param string $block_content Rendered block content. | ||
* @param array $block Block object. | ||
* | ||
* @return string Filtered block content. | ||
*/ | ||
function gutenberg_render_variation_support( $block_content, $block ) { | ||
if ( ! $block_content || empty( $block['attrs'] ) ) { | ||
return $block_content; |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Apply the variation's classname. Like the layout hook, this assumes the | ||
// hook only applies to blocks with a single wrapper. | ||
$tags = new WP_HTML_Tag_Processor( $block_content ); | ||
|
||
if ( $tags->next_tag() ) { | ||
preg_match( '/\bis-style-(\S+)\b/', $tags->get_attribute( 'class' ), $matches ); | ||
$variation = $matches[1] ?? null; | ||
|
||
if ( $variation ) { | ||
$tree = WP_Theme_JSON_Resolver_Gutenberg::get_merged_data(); | ||
$theme_json = $tree->get_raw_data(); | ||
|
||
if ( ! empty( $theme_json['styles']['blocks'][ $block['blockName'] ]['variations'][ $variation ] ) ) { | ||
$tags->add_class( gutenberg_get_variation_class_name( $block, $variation ) );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
return $tags->get_updated_html(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Render the block style variation's styles. | ||
* | ||
* In the case of nested blocks with variations applies, we want the parent | ||
* variation's styles to be rendered before their descendants. This solves the | ||
* issue of a block type being styled in both the parent and descendant: we want | ||
* the descendant style to take priority, and this is done by loading it after, | ||
* in the DOM order. This is why the variation stylesheet generation is in a | ||
* different filter. | ||
* | ||
* @param string|null $pre_render The pre-rendered content. Default null. | ||
* @param array $block The block being rendered. | ||
* | ||
* @return null | ||
*/ | ||
function gutenberg_render_variation_support_styles( $pre_render, $block ) { | ||
$variation = $block['attrs']['style']['variation'] ?? null; | ||
|
||
if ( ! $variation ) { | ||
return null; | ||
} | ||
|
||
$tree = WP_Theme_JSON_Resolver_Gutenberg::get_merged_data(); | ||
$theme_json = $tree->get_raw_data(); | ||
$variation_data = $theme_json['styles']['blocks'][ $block['blockName'] ]['variations'][ $variation ] ?? array(); | ||
|
||
if ( empty( $variation_data['elements'] ) && empty( $variation_data['blocks'] ) ) { | ||
return null; | ||
} | ||
|
||
$config = array( | ||
'version' => 2, | ||
'styles' => $variation_data, | ||
); | ||
|
||
$class_name = gutenberg_get_variation_class_name( $block, $variation ); | ||
$class_name = ".$class_name"; | ||
|
||
$variation_theme_json = new WP_Theme_JSON_Gutenberg( $config, 'blocks' ); | ||
$variation_styles = $variation_theme_json->get_stylesheet( | ||
array( 'styles' ), | ||
array( 'custom' ), | ||
array( | ||
'root_selector' => $class_name, | ||
'skip_root_layout_styles' => true, | ||
'scope' => $class_name, | ||
) | ||
); | ||
|
||
if ( empty( $variation_styles ) ) { | ||
return null; | ||
} | ||
|
||
wp_register_style( 'variation-styles', false ); | ||
wp_add_inline_style( 'variation-styles', $variation_styles ); | ||
wp_enqueue_style( 'variation-styles' ); | ||
} | ||
|
||
|
||
// Register the block support. | ||
WP_Block_Supports::get_instance()->register( 'variation', array() ); | ||
|
||
add_filter( 'pre_render_block', 'gutenberg_render_variation_support_styles', 10, 2 ); | ||
add_filter( 'render_block', 'gutenberg_render_variation_support', 10, 2 ); |
